Linux Boot Process Explained
Download Now from Google Play
https://play.google.com/store/apps/details?id=com.piembsystech&pcampaignid=web_share
Visit for more :
https://piembsystech.com/
Linux Boot Process Explained
Download Now from Google Play
https://play.google.com/store/apps/details?id=com.piembsystech&pcampaignid=web_share
Visit for more :
https://piembsystech.com/
Habemus ELFs! Not the fantasy creatures. But just a set of organized bit and bytes.
I managed to make my #kernel #dreamos64 launch its first ELF executable, although is just printing a message.
ELF support is still very limited, but, is still a great achievement for my toy project.
More info on my free #kofi post: https://ko-fi.com/post/Habemus-ELFs-Q5Q6160TJI
#osdev #operatingsystemdevelopment #programming #systemprogramming #kernelprogramming #osdever #operatingsystem #hobbyos #hobbykernel
After more than two months another Dreamos64 update. Not new features but fixes and improvements, full story on #ko-fi
https://ko-fi.com/post/Dreamos64-Status-update-U6U71340LC (free).
I found a nasty bug in a core memory function, where i was returning true instead of false and viceversa. Also some code refactor and documentation improvements.
UA: Здоров мастадонці! Я роздумував про зміну стеку
і мені цікаво чи може хтось кинути хороший курс по C++ бо я щось не впевнений у тому, що дає гугл
Наперед дякую!
EN: Sup mastadonians! I was thinking about changing the tech stack
and I wonder if someone could give me good online course for learning C++ because I'm not sure about what Google throws me
Thanks in advance!
Habemus #scrolling (nearly) :)
I'm working on adding framebuffer scrolling in #Dreamos64
Initially it will be just scrolling the text up, when it reach the last line.
#osdev #kernel #operatingsystemdevelopment #programming #framebuffer #systemprogramming #kernelprogramming #osdever #operatingsystem #hobbyos
I saw a chart about wages in programming languages
When it comes to "system programming " languages, it turns out Zig is gonna be rewarded more than Rust
But I never read about Zig on the fediverse, I only run into Rust
Why is that ?
Introducing #Lapce: https://bit.ly/3T46WwE
Written in #Rustlang, Lapce sports a native GUI leveraging GPU acceleration and an extensible plugin system based on WASI. It comes with support for syntax highlighting, code completion, and code diagnostics using any LSP-compliant server.
Zed is now an #opensource project!
Dive into a #CodeEditor that's all about performance, AI integration, and supports software teams’ collaboration out of the box.
Learn more about this exciting project on #InfoQ: https://bit.ly/49MpbgM
@astro Quick update... #Frontend Web development turned out more challenging to me than expected and found little joy on build something graphic (just personal taste) so even though I'll keep focusing on #Backend and #SystemProgramming I still have some cool projects on my Backlog that I'll be more than happy to handover or collaborate with interested parties
#SystemProgramming Quiz
Given that you only have the range of line and char position of a file changes, how do you modify/update that file without reading it?
Some time ago I saw a talk about the evolution of the C standard with just a bit of neew features added, recently
I'd love to find it again
So ATM, I'm in the middle of writing a reader writer spinlock. My question is why a standard one doesn't exist?
For example, pthreads have spin lock, and a full reader writer lock. Is this niche, or is there a fundamental reason this is a bad idea?
#CaseStudy - TrueLayer's main business is not #systemprogramming, yet they decided to bet on #Rust. Why? How?
Luca Palmieri shares their adoption story, expectations, challenges, doubts, the mistakes they made & the lessons they learned.
#InfoQ video: http://bit.ly/3HZnctc